public final class QueryVCFParser extends AbstractQueryParser
BED_FIELD, format, INFO_COL, INFO_FIELD_SEPARATOR, logger, NULLVALUE, TAB, VCF_FIELD, VCF_HEADER_INDICATOR, VCF_INFO_EQUAL
Constructor and Description |
---|
QueryVCFParser(Format format,
VCFParser vcfParser) |
Modifier and Type | Method and Description |
---|---|
htsjdk.variant.vcf.VCFHeader |
getVCFHeader() |
java.lang.String |
toBEDHeader(java.util.StringJoiner dbHeader) |
java.lang.String |
toBEDRecord(LocFeature query,
java.util.StringJoiner dbjoiner) |
java.lang.String |
toVCFHeader() |
java.lang.String |
toVCFRecord(LocFeature query,
java.util.StringJoiner dbjoiner) |
getBEDDataStart, getBEDHeaderStart
public java.lang.String toVCFHeader()
toVCFHeader
in class AbstractQueryParser
public java.lang.String toBEDHeader(java.util.StringJoiner dbHeader)
toBEDHeader
in class AbstractQueryParser
public java.lang.String toVCFRecord(LocFeature query, java.util.StringJoiner dbjoiner)
toVCFRecord
in class AbstractQueryParser
public java.lang.String toBEDRecord(LocFeature query, java.util.StringJoiner dbjoiner)
toBEDRecord
in class AbstractQueryParser
public htsjdk.variant.vcf.VCFHeader getVCFHeader()
getVCFHeader
in class AbstractQueryParser